Tuna is a top feeder (i.e. eats lots of other little fishes) and has a lot of mercury.
There is a lot of info about how much is safe to eat. http://www.health.state.mn.us/divs/e...afeeating.html has some guidelines and for little ones and pregnant mamas it's only 2X month.
Personally, I'd find a different source of proteins for her.
